compiled this information for my son to boost his financial awareness
Circle
The U.S. $1 coin is a circle. Once upon a time, all U.S coins were originally gold, silver, or copper.
Square
This Thai 60 Baht note is square. It was produced in 1987 to celebrate the 60th birthday of the then-King.
Rectangle
These Euro notes are rectangles. 19 European Union countries use the Euro currency.
Triangle
The pyramid in the U.S. $1 note is made of triangles. The pyramid represents strength and longevity.
Star
This U.S. bill contains a star after the serial number. U.S. bills with a star are replacement notes that are printed to replace notes that are damaged during printing.
